Scene status, POV and keywords #

Every scene can carry a status — Outline, First draft, Revised or Final — a POV or tag, and any keywords you like. Status and flags show as a colored dot on the node, so the state of a section is visible without opening anything.

These are what the search filters read. Marking scenes as you go is what makes “every unrevised scene in Nora's POV” a question you can actually ask.

The scrap pile #

Nothing you delete is destroyed. Scenes, chapters and acts removed from the outline go to the Scrap Pile, along with entity blocks and anything else you cut, and can be restored from there.

That is what makes cutting bearable: you can take a paragraph out to see whether the chapter is better without it, knowing you can put it back in a month when it turns out you were wrong.
